Deep dark brown coloured body, almost black aside from the bottom - which is nice and brown. Good two centimetre tall light brown head that fades to about 1cm after a few seconds. Aroma of alcohol, grapes, raisins, toasted malt, nuts, alcohol and way more grape scents - strong and very nice. Medium to Full-bodied; Sweet prune, plum, raisin and grape flavours at first with a good malt balance, some nuts and a bit of bitter flavours followed by a strong and pungent deep alcohol burn. Aftertaste shows a lot of character with a ton of sweetness, malt, yeast, nuts, earth and a ton of deep pitted fruits. Overall, a nice and complex beer that shows a lot of fruit, alcohol, malt and some pleasant yeast. Definitely nice to try if you can find it and keep it for a while to mellow out the flavours a bit.
